1. Get Your Beauty Sleep – Yes, Really!

The number one culprit behind those unsightly bags? Lack of sleep. High school life can be hectic, but getting enough Zzz’s is non-negotiable. Aim for at least 8 hours of sleep each night. Set a bedtime routine, avoid screens before bed, and create a cozy sleep environment. Trust us, your eyes will thank you. 🛌🌙

2. Hydrate and Eat Right – It’s Not Just About Looks!

Drinking plenty of water and eating a balanced diet can work wonders for your skin. Water helps flush out toxins and reduces puffiness, while a diet rich in vitamins C and K can improve blood circulation and reduce dark circles. Swap those sugary drinks for H2O and snack on fruits and veggies instead. Your body (and your eyes) will feel the difference! 🍎💧

3. Eye Care Routine: Treat Your Peepers Right!

A simple yet effective eye care routine can do wonders. Use a gentle cleanser, apply a hydrating eye cream, and don’t forget to wear sunscreen. Look for products with caffeine or retinol, which can help reduce puffiness and brighten the under-eye area. And remember, less is often more when it comes to applying products around your delicate eye area. 🧴✨

4. DIY Remedies and Quick Fixes

Sometimes you need a quick fix to get you through the day. Cold compresses, like chilled spoons or cucumber slices, can temporarily reduce puffiness. Tea bags, especially those containing caffeine, can also help. Simply steep them in hot water, then chill them in the fridge before placing them over your eyes for 10 minutes. Instant refresh! 🍵❄️

5. Embrace Concealer and Makeup Magic

While it’s great to tackle the root causes of under-eye issues, sometimes a little makeup magic is needed. Opt for a concealer that matches your skin tone perfectly and apply it gently with a brush or your fingertips. Don’t forget to set it with a light dusting of powder to ensure it stays put all day long. Voila! Perfectly camouflaged eye bags. 🧶💄
